Is Andiroba Seed Oil comedogenic?
Yes. Andiroba Seed Oil is a known pore-clogging ingredient, and we read it as highly comedogenic. If you're acne-prone, it's worth avoiding, especially when it sits near the top of an ingredient list.
Why we read it this way
A rich seed or nut oil whose fatty-acid profile is reported to congest pores in concentrated, leave-on use on the face.
The nuance
Often fine on the body or on resilient skin; the concern is concentrated, leave-on use on breakout-prone areas.
